Okta provides a cloud-based platform that manages and secures digital identities for businesses and government agencies. The software works by centralizing user authentication through tools like single sign-on and multi-factor authentication, allowing employees to access all their work applications with one secure login. Unlike traditional hardware-based security, Okta operates entirely in the cloud, making it easier to manage remote workforces and automate the process of granting or removing access as employees join or leave a company. The company's goal is to ensure that the right individuals have secure access to the right digital resources at the right time.

Okta buys AI security startup Permiso; source says for about $200M.

Okta buys AI security startup Permiso; source says for about $200M. 9:09 AM PDT · July 30, 2026 Okta on Thursday agreed to acquire AI identity security startup Permiso Security, betting that demand for protecting AI agents and other machine identities will grow as enterprises deploy autonomous software across their operations. The identity management company did not disclose the terms of the transaction. But TechCrunch has learned that the acquisition is valued at just under $200 million and is structured as an almost all-cash deal, according to a source with knowledge of the deal. A spokesperson for Okta did not dispute the figure when asked by TechCrunch, but would not comment on specifics of the deal terms. The deal is expected to close in the third quarter of its fiscal 2027, Okta said, subject to customary closing conditions. Okta's move to buy Permiso comes as identity management companies seek to expand beyond verifying users at login to continuously monitoring what users, applications, and AI agents do once gaining authorized access to a network environment. That shift has intensified competition to secure machine identities as enterprises embed AI deeper into everyday operations. Permiso, which emerged from stealth in 2022, develops software that helps security teams spot suspicious activity in cloud environments after users or applications have been granted access. More recently, the startup has expanded its platform to monitor AI agents and other machine identities. Co-founded by former FireEye executives Paul Nguyen and Jason Martin, Permiso specializes in detecting attacks that use stolen or compromised identities to move through cloud infrastructure. In April, the startup also introduced SandyClaw, a platform designed to analyze AI agent skills in a sandboxed environment to identify malicious behavior before they are deployed. The deal strengthens Okta's push into securing AI agents and other non-human identities alongside its core identity management business. "Permiso will extend Okta's identity security fabric with proven identity threat detection and response capabilities, and an incredible threat research and security team that will advance Okta's threat detection and prevention capabilities," Okta's chief product officer Ely Kahn said in a prepared statement. Permiso has raised about $29 million to date, including an $18.5 million Series A round in April 2024 led by Altimeter Capital. People familiar with the financing said the Series A valued the Palo Alto-based startup at about $80 million on a post-money basis. Bloom Security launches with $20M seed to secure the ai-native endpoint.

Bloom Security launches with $20M seed to secure the ai-native endpoint. FinanceWire Jul. 30, 2026, 07:10 AM New York, USA, July 30th, 2026, FinanceWire The enterprise endpoint is undergoing a fundamental shift as AI agents, browser extensions, MCP servers and code packages become part of everyday work. While companies have spent years building defenses around traditional endpoints, the software running on employee devices is becoming more dynamic, decentralized and difficult for security teams to track. Bloom Security is entering that market with a $20 million seed round led by Glilot Capital Partners and Ten Eleven Ventures (1011vc), with participation from Okta Ventures and Runtime Ventures. Axios first reported about the company's launch and funding. The Tel Aviv-based startup is emerging from stealth with a focus on securing what it describes as the AI-native endpoint, where traditional endpoint security controls may not provide enough visibility into the tools and software employees are using. The Endpoint Is Becoming More Complex For years, endpoint security largely centered on managed devices and the detection of malware, malicious processes and suspicious executables. The rise of AI-powered software is changing that environment, with employees increasingly using tools that can install extensions, connect to external services or interact with sensitive data. "In the AI era, the employee device is no longer just a managed endpoint," said Itay Keren, Co-Founder and CEO of Bloom Security. "Every endpoint is now running software no one reviewed, connecting to services no one provisioned." That creates a broader category of risks that may not fit neatly into conventional endpoint detection and response systems. A misconfigured AI agent, a plugin with excessive permissions, a screen recorder or a code library from an untrusted source can all introduce potential exposure, even when the software itself is not classified as malware. "As AI adoption accelerated, it became clear that existing endpoint controls were not designed for this new reality," Keren added. "Security teams need a way to understand, govern, and control modern tools without disrupting how employees work." Moving Beyond Traditional Endpoint Visibility Bloom Security's platform is designed to provide organizations with visibility into software running across their endpoints, including tools, browser extensions and code. It also examines how those components interact with data and systems, while analyzing supply-chain risks, configurations and permissions. The company's approach is based on the idea that endpoint risk cannot always be determined by looking at an individual application in isolation. The same software may present different levels of risk depending on who is using it, what data they can access and what other tools are active on the device. "The same tool can be completely acceptable on one endpoint and high-risk on another," said Ofir Balassiano, Co-Founder and Chief Product Officer at Bloom Security. "Risk depends on context: the user's role, their access to sensitive data, the other tools operating on that endpoint, their configurations, and how everything interacts. Bloom Security was designed to evaluate that context in real time." The platform also extends beyond visibility into enforcement and remediation. According to the company, security teams can block risky installations before they reach employee endpoints, enforce secure configurations and remediate risks without relying on manual approval workflows. A Team Built Around Enterprise Security Bloom Security's founding team has experience building security products at companies that include Palo Alto Networks, Dig Security and Demisto. Keren previously held engineering and sales engineering leadership roles at Palo Alto Networks, Dig Security and Demisto, while Balassiano led the Cortex Cloud Posture Security research group at Palo Alto Networks. Chief Technology Officer Itay Frishman previously built AISPM and DSPM solutions at Palo Alto Networks and Dig Security. The company currently has 30 employees, many of whom previously worked together at Dig Security. "While this is technically our first company as founders, our team has built and integrated category-defining products before," said Itay Frishman, Co-Founder and CTO. "We understand how enterprise security environments operate, and we built Bloom Security specifically for the reality of how endpoints are used today." Bloom Security said its platform is already deployed at dozens of large enterprises across the United States and Europe. The company's latest funding will support its effort to address a growing security challenge: giving organizations more visibility and control over the expanding software layer that now sits on employee endpoints as AI adoption accelerates.
